Output 17e4f6c60dc00bb13d4a0ee7df9d050e338313a18384176abaa116d9bb500f50:184

value
123868
script pubkey
OP_0 OP_PUSHBYTES_20 83f89cc73f433a0481e52c34d032c29c15b5f136
address
bc1qs0ufe3elgvaqfq099s6dqvkzns2mtufkyff4w3
transaction
17e4f6c60dc00bb13d4a0ee7df9d050e338313a18384176abaa116d9bb500f50